I thoroughly enjoyed the series -- some volumes more than others -- so I felt the need to rate each one individually, but summarize here. I do believe that: (1) The series "dragged" on much longer than it needed to; the same story could have been covered in, perhaps, eight books with fewer characters. Toward the end I felt as though the profit motive may have overwhelmed the authors. (2) While some of the better scenes are downright chilling, there is also a bevy of superfluous and unrealistic dialogue (ie. some of the conversations in heaven seemed ridiculous -- this is heaven, not the post office). (3) Overall, I think the authors included too many unrealistic character traits among the central characters -- the pilot who almost cheats on his wife, the international news reporter who is a virgin at thirty. I would have preferred to see more "sinners" than saints, and I think it would have made the heartbroken moments deeper. Christians have messy, upended, broken lives just like everyone else, and maybe the more that is communicated the more people will be open to Christ. As C.S.
